Southeast Asia’s digital transformation is accelerating at unprecedented speed. Governments and businesses are embracing artificial intelligence (AI), cloud computing and digital inclusion to boost competitiveness and create opportunities across the region. AI alone could contribute between 10% and 18% of Asean’s GDP by 2030, a sign that digitalisation has become a collective regional priority.

As leaders gathered in Malaysia for the recent ASEAN Summit in October, the question was not only how to scale AI, but whether the region has the resilient, reliable and sustainable power infrastructure needed to support it.
